Effects of transcutaneous electrical diaphragmatic stimulation on the cardiac autonomic balance in healthy individuals: a randomized clinical trial
ABSTRACT The transcutaneous electrical diaphragmatic stimulation (TEDS) is a technique of respiratory muscle activation that affects breathing pattern and rhythm.
